Washroom floor covering
Try to stay clear of the urge to position carpets on the washroom floor, according to the study it is not too favoured. The study revealed that the recommended floor covering was ceramic tiles, with 75 percent saying they "liked" a tiled washroom floor. Popular vinyl floor covering has actually not yet shed its place in the shower room, with greater than 61 per cent stating they really did not have any kind of strong sort or disapproval towards it.
When selecting your bathroom flooring, floor tiles is the favoured option, however if the spending plan is tight, then plastic floor covering won't allow you down.
In addition to the flooring, make certain your home windows look appealing. When it comes to dressing your shower room home windows, steer clear of those restroom internet and also fabric curtains. The study revealed that 94 per cent said they favoured blinds in the shower room to drapes.
Shower power
When intending the design of your restroom, among one of the most important aspects to think about is positioning a shower. Some washrooms do not have adequate area to consist of a shower work area, so analyze your alternatives. Take into consideration installing a shower over the bath if area is limited.
The study revealed that 94 percent of its individuals thought that a shower in a bathroom was very essential, as well as 81 percent claimed they favored a different shower enclosure in a large bathroom. Practically 65 per cent stated their suitable would be a power shower, while 27 percent liked mixer showers, and only 12 per cent chose electric showers.
If you have actually selected a shower over the bathroom, after that consider putting a set glass display rather than a shower drape. It might cost a few additional pounds, however over half of the survey's contributors chose a fixed glass screen to a shower curtain.
Choosing your tub
Contrary to common belief, adding a whirlpool bath to increase property value does not constantly suffice. So if you're pondering offering your residential property, attempt to prevent purchasing a whirlpool bath in the hopes of gaining additional earnings.
The study exposed that near to 53 per cent of its participants were not phased by them, while just a tiny 38 percent of participants "loved" them. Remarkably, 62 per cent stated they had "no strong view" in the direction of edge baths either, which means the traditional rectangle-shaped bathrooms still hold influence against their beautified counter components.
Hey there simplicity
From as far back as the 1960s much focus was positioned on strong colour in the restroom. Formed wall surface tiles of nautical animals as well as over-the-top colours were the pattern, along with plastic. Plastic washroom décor was the fad, from strong orange, olive green, mustard yellow and also chocolate brownish coloured toothbrush, soap and also towel owners, to thick patterned plastic shower drapes that yelled colours of the boldest nature.
As the times went on, the 1970s as well as early 1980s came to be a period when gold washroom correctings and equipping, such as taps, towel rails and toilet roll owners, were considered really elegant. These ostentatious gold cut features were in vogue, as well as bathroom design was 'loud'. Added to this were those when delightful shower room suites in colours avocado, coral reefs pink, and delicious chocolate brown. Shower room colour has changed substantially over the past decade, and also shades have actually become a lot more neutral, sometimes with a tip of colour that includes a corresponding vigour to the overall plan.
Of the many hundreds of people that took part in Plumbworld's current bathroom survey, a frustrating 82 percent said they "hated" the as soon as glorified avocado as well as reefs pink restroom collections, colours residue of 1970s as well as 1980s, which are commonly characterised as being dark and also dull.
According to the survey, chrome washroom faucets were much chosen to gold.
So, when creating and embellishing your washroom keep those dark colours at bay, think about white collections, and choose chrome correctings and also furnishings instead of flashy gold.
Keep it tidy
If you are intending to put your house on the marketplace, evaluate your bathroom for those little normally undetected flaws, like mould on the silicone sealant around the bath, as well as also on your shower drape if you have one. Potential homebuyers may observe these tiny mistakes, which can send then running!
The 5 Benefits Of Renovating Your Bathroom
Looking for simple renovations that will give your home a face lift? Start with your bathroom, especially if you have pink tile and a baby blue toilet. Outdated bathrooms can stop potential buyers in their tracks. Even if you're not looking to sell, it's nice to feel like you're living in the current decade. Besides increasing the value of your home, the bathroom can be a place to get creative and have some fun. Here are five major benefits a bathroom re-do can offer:
Increase your home's value
According to HGTV.com, a minor bathroom remodel gives you a 102% return at resale. A minor remodel encompasses replacing the tub, tile surround, floor, toilet, sink, vanity, and fixtures, then perhaps finishing off the project with a fresh coat of paint on the walls. As you renovate, keep in mind the color and decorating trends of today and if those trends will have lasting value in the future.
Save money now
Replacing leaky faucets, adding aerators, and installing an on-demand water heater and a water-efficient toilet will save you big bucks on utility costs.
Become a more peaceful oasis
Performing your daily ablutions in a messy, unattractive space with old, substandard fixtures can be a source of stress. With a renovation, you can unwind in a claw-foot tub and dry off afterwards with heated towels. You can choose colors and textures that will help you relax and soothe stress away, taking you to your happy place.
Reduce clutter
Poorly designed bathrooms invite clutter, so when you renovate you can increase storage capacity with the smart designs available in today's cabinetry. You can finally find discreet homes for your towels, cleaners, toiletries, and medicines.
Become more eco-friendly
You can reclaim and repurpose an older porcelain sink, saving it from a landfill. Or you can buy new fixtures and materials from companies developing products that are energy-efficient, low-tox, biodegradable, and/or recyclable.
